[QUOTE="PSJBrock, post: 114516, member: 1050"] With gas prices going up and the weather getting nice I figured it was time to get a nice little scoot to shoot back and forth to work in. So I cruised my local craigslist and found this gem. 2004 450 MXC. It has definitely been ridden HARD. It has a fresh top end in it and fires right up. [ATTACH=full]10213[/ATTACH] [ATTACH=full]10214[/ATTACH] I am going to have to replace the wheels. I am going to re-lace new wheels to the hubs, since I guess the previous owner doesn't like to run any air pressure in the tires while riding. I have never seen dents in wheels like this. I am surprised the tire even sets the bead. [ATTACH=full]10215[/ATTACH] [ATTACH=full]10216[/ATTACH] Also came with this special steering Damper made by RTT. I have never heard of them but it is a trick little piece. It has a knob on the handlebar that adjust the damper sort of like the GPR but not quite. The damper is integrated into the triple clamp which makes for a clean piece. [ATTACH=full]10217[/ATTACH] [ATTACH=full]10218[/ATTACH] [/QUOTE]
